vim配置文件
set fileencodings=utf-8,ucs-bom,gb18030,gbk,gb2312,cp936 set termencoding=utf-8 set encoding=utf-8 set number set mouse=a set selection=exclusive set selectmode=mouse,key set showmatch set tabstop=...
set fileencodings=utf-8,ucs-bom,gb18030,gbk,gb2312,cp936 set termencoding=utf-8 set encoding=utf-8 set number set mouse=a set selection=exclusive set selectmode=mouse,key set showmatch set tabstop=...
公司最近开发小程序,涉及到支付功能. 现在支付功能已经做完,特此记录一下自己踩坑经验: 众所周知,微信小程序目前只能使用微信支付, 而且微信小程序支付相对于app支付,h5支付都要简单一些,但是该支付文档对java这语言是非常不友好的,居然没有demo, 网上虽说有很多博客,但是找了好多都是跑不通, 乱七八糟的很多都跑不通, 以下 代码不是自己写的,大多都是这儿抄一点哪儿抄一顿,但是能跑通,...
最近朋友公司有个需求说是因为开发部署到现场比较麻烦, 因为浏览器设置等等一些东西, 所以需要打包成普通的安装软件, 然后就有了这篇文章… 网上搜了一下解决办法, 都太麻烦, 习惯性看了一下github, 还真发现了一个 牛逼的项目, 于是写个博客记录一下吧.. 本地安装node: 这个就不多说了, 直接安装node就可以了,如果不懂直接百度去吧,教程很多. 安装软...
cd keppelfei # 拉一下新代码 git pull # 切换主分支 git checkout master # 开始打包镜像 ./gradlew clean build dockerBuilder --info # 停止当前运行的docker镜像 docker stop gradle-boot # 删除docker镜像 sudo docker rm $(sudo docker ps...
最近在研究一个github上面的 SpringCloud开源项目, 该项目使用到了一些不是中央仓库的包, 这些个包是作者自己搞的, 虽说提供了, 但是没有走仓库下载总感觉少了点啥, 为此搭建了一个私人仓库来解决依赖的问题, 话不多说,开整! 想要使用私服必须要做2件事, 第一件事:在项目的根 pom 文件中添加私服仓库的配置地址等相关信息: <repositories&g...
一、查找数据 部分字段不存在时查询 db.post.find({'worksAspectRatio':{$exists:false}}).count() 排序查找 db.col.find({},{"title":1,_id:0}).sort({"likes":-1}) 更新文档 db.plan.update({_id:ObjectId("5bce8ffb...
一、背景 随着互联网技术发展, 老的分布式文件系统HDFS逐步已经被商家的对象存储替代了,完全包装好的技术, 完善的API文档, 用的不要太舒服, 本文记录SpringBoot项目集成七牛云对象存储. 二、准备工作 首先要去七牛云注册账号, 这个流程我就不多说了, 注册完成后, 开一个bucket, 相当于一个仓库吧! 上面有2个东西要记下, 一个是仓库名字, 一个是访问域...
一、背景: 最近公司有个项目需要使用rabbitmq来做优化, 之前一直听说没有实战, 然后自己在网上找了一些资料, 资料真的很多, 但是实例基本没有, 都是log一句话什么的, 很头痛… 该博文抄了很多博主然后结合自己的了解做了一些改动,实现了我要的效果. 自己折腾一下,权当记录一下! 二、rabbitmq介绍 介绍就没有什么必要了, 网上资料一大堆, 说的都很好. 这里主要是...
一、初始工作 Swagger的相关介绍我就不多BB了, 百度介绍的很清晰, 首先国际惯例直接引入相关依赖 <!-- https://mvnrepository.com/artifact/io.springfox/springfox-swagger2 --> <dependency> <groupId>io.springfox</groupI...